Cheer up Steelers fans! All those cheesy hats and t-shirts you were dying to wear will go to those in need over seas, thanks to the good people at World Vision: Preprinted shirts, sweatshirts and hats that claim the Steelers won Super Bowl XLV will be shipped to people in other countries. Volunteers at World Vision, in Sewickley, prepared the clothing for shipment on Wednesday. The organization received 150 boxes of items valued at nearly $200,000. The items will be shipped within the next few months and for the first time ever a group of NFL players will help deliver the merchandise. $200k In Steelers Super Bowl Victory Gear Donated To Needy Countries [WPXI]

GM’s balance sheet draws praise ahead of IPO [MarketWatch]
“Peter Bible, partner-in-charge at accounting firm EisnerAmper LLP, said General Motors is now carrying a much stronger balance sheet than its predecessor, based on the company’s initial public offering filed late Wednesday. ‘Their debt-to-equity ratio looks handsome,’ Bible said in an interview. ‘This thing has gotten restructured quite a bit. GM’s health care liabilities have fallen significantly. As I look at the balance sheet, it is much healthier.’ ”
